A flask contains 36% nitrogen ,39% oxygen and 26% hydrogen. If the total pressure of the mixture of gases is 500 mm, the partial pressure of oxygen is

Options

(a) 120 mm
(b) 145 mm
(c) 195 mm
(d) 210 mm

Correct Answer:

195 mm

Explanation:

According to Dalton’s law of partial pressures
P(total) = Pɴ₂ + Po₂ + Pʜ₂
As the % age of oxygen is 39% and total pressure is 500 mm.
.·. Partial pressure os oxygen is 39% of 500 = 195 mm
